Fodor's Fodor's
"Göteborg's oldest hotel, built in 1852, is small, family-owned, and traditional. Make a stop in the entrance hall to admire the intricate, original ceiling paintings." Full review
Frommer's Frommer's
"What makes this a good choice is that it is completely renovated, and is today better than ever." Full review
Rough Guide Rough Guide
"Dating from 1852 and the oldest hotel in Gothenburg, this place oozes grandeur and charm, from the Art Nouveau marble staircase to the individually decorated rooms."
